Hotsprings and Nature: A Winning Formula at Papallacta

Ecuador’s volcanic peaks provide amazing backdrops to the countryside of the highlands around Quito. But Mother Nature has also gifted Ecuador with an amazing byproduct of all this volcanic activity: hotsprings. There are many spots to enjoy these curative and relaxing gifts of nature, but the most famous and best-equipped are the hotsprings of the Papallacta Thermal Spa and Resort, located a mere 40 miles east of the capital, this year celebrating 15 years as a business.


Papallacta Thermal Spa and Resort has proved a remarkably successful business in Ecuador. It has expanded from its beginnings as a humble ‘municipal’ baths to the country’s foremost thermal spring complex, offering a wide range of services, from thermoludic therapies, a hotel, restaurant, convention centre and nature trails.


Located up in the Andean highlands at some 3,300 metres (nearly 11,000 feet) above sea level, the management of the company has been very aware of the fragile ecosystem of their base, and their impact upon it. The large Cayambe-Coca Ecological Reserve (914,270 acres or 3,700 km2), for instance, is adjacent to the complex, and is one of Ecuador’s most biodiverse protected areas (its wetland zone was named as a special Ramsar site in 2006).
For this reason, Papallacta has been at the forefront of implementing best practices, constantly improving not only its services and infrastructure, but also its environmental and social management policies. In 2005, for example, the company became the first in the Quito Metropolitan District to be awarded the Smart Voyager certification (www.smartvoyager.org) for best practices in tourism and has worked closely with the NGO Rainforest Alliance on sustainable tourism initiatives in the Amazon Basin. It will also soon be ISO 9001-2008 certified.


The company created its own non-profit foundation, Fundacion Terra, in 1999, which organizes environmental education initiatives in the surrounding communities and various ecological projects, such as ‘El Exploratorio’ a 250-hectare area dedicated to highlighting the fragility and importance of the high Andean ecosystem. On the medical front, the Ecuadorian Medical Federation certifies that the thermal waters of Termas de Papallacta have medicinal properties with wide-ranging health benefits.

Looking ahead, Papallacta is seeking to become ever-more self-sufficient. It will soon begin building its own micro-hydroelectric installation, and will increase the area dedicated to producing organic vegetables and greens.

The formula at Papallacta of “health, recreation, adventure and rest” has proved popular with both national and international visitors. These can enjoy a day out from Quito, with various massages and therapeutic treatments (body treatments with medicinal Andean mud, baths in the Thermal Cave,  Volcanic hot-stone massages, pressure massages, aromatherapy or therapeutic massages, or face and body treatments, for example), lunch and walks amid the mountain trails. But staying the night at the complex is really an experience not to be missed, with the chance of soaking in the hotsprings while the clouds and stars play hide-and-seek in the night skies above.
